301 Edgewater Place, Suite 100 Wakefield, MA 01880 United States
Inquiries concerning clinical studies conducted in the US will be addressed only when submitted by healthcare professionals.
Cookies To make this site work properly, we sometimes place small data files called cookies on your device. Most big websites do this too.
Read more
You are leaving the US website. The content of the website you are seeking to access is not intended for a US audience and may contain information that is not applicable to the US. Do you wish to continue?